A video showing a group of men using ropes to rescue youths stranded in the middle of a raging river is being widely shared on social media platforms, with several users linking it to the recent flash floods in Uttarakhand’s Uttarkashi district following a cloudburst on Tuesday (August 5, 2025).

Multiple X, Facebook and YouTube users shared the over-two-minute-long-footage with a Hindi text overlay reading, “New video of Dharali village.”

Newschecker’s investigation, however, revealed that the video was not related to the recent Uttarkashi cloudburst.

Rescue & Relief Work In Uttarkashi

The NDRF, SDRF, Army, Indo-Tibetan Border Police (ITBP), police and other related agencies are involved in the relief and rescue work in Uttarkashi district hit by flash floods. The teams rescued 190 people from Dharali on Wednesday (August 6, 2025) and around 65  others have been airlifted to Matli so far on Thursday (August 7, 2025). Fact Check/Verification 

A reverse image search on the keyframes of the viral clip led us to a report by The Indian Express, dated July 29, 2022, detailing an incident in Himachal Pradesh’s Solan where five youths were rescued by locals after they were trapped in the river in Nalagarh. The report featured snippets of the viral footage, confirming that it was unrelated to the recent calamity in Uttarkashi.

Another report by The Tribune, published on July 29, 2022, also carried visuals showing the same incident, corroborated that it shows the rescue of the youths who were stuck in a river in Solan’s Nalagarh, adding that they had gone into the river to take photos.

Detailing the effects of incessant rainfall across states, an Aaj Tak report from July 2022, too, featured the snippets from the now viral footage to show locals rescuing youths stuck in a river in Himachal Pradesh’s Solan.

The Uttarakhand Police also flagged the viral clip, clarifying that it was unrelated to the recent disaster in Dharali.

Conclusion

Hence, we find that the viral posts, claiming to show the rescue of men stranded in a river in Dharali following the recent cloudburst, are false.
